Document Transport — Print Shop Master Copies

Quick guide for moving master copies to Bramblehurst Print Co. These are the only originals, so treat the run like a valuables transfer, not a regular parcel drop. Use the red tamper-evident envelopes from the supply shelf, log the seal number in the transport book, and never combine the run with general mail. The masters go directly to the press supervisor, nobody else. On arrival, the courier must follow the hand-over instruction stated below.

drop instructions, kajep-tageg: the kasvan casdor courier leaves the quenvan quenox druox ledger at gate 4316 under passcode 799004

## Releases

Heads up, release manager: Squishlink ships two builds per release — one with permessage-deflate enabled and one without, since compression saves bandwidth but costs CPU and adds latency on small frames. Tag both, run the tradeoff benchmark suite, and attach the results to the release notes so downstream folks can pick sensibly. Both artifacts must be signed before the registry will accept them, no exceptions. When you're ready to sign, use the current release key:

release key, fajef-kajeg: bky19_LdLu6Ne6FLi8he2c24d

## Read-Replica Lag Alarm

New folks: the ReplicaLagHigh alarm covers the Ostrel reporting replicas. It fires when lag exceeds 90 seconds for five minutes. Most triggers come from the nightly Bramwell export job, which is expected and auto-resolves. Do not fail over the replica yourself — that requires the data-platform lead's approval and a change ticket. If the alarm persists past 20 minutes with no export running, write to the platform inbox.

billing contact of yahip-yadup = eliax.druix@zemvarworks.corp

## 1.14.2 — Setting renamed

`QUOTA_MAX` is now `TENANT_RATE_QUOTA` to reflect per-tenant enforcement in Brellix Gateway. Old name is read with a deprecation warning until 1.16. Quotas apply per tenant, not per node, so halve existing values on multi-node clusters. Migration script lives in tools/rename_quota. The quota service authenticates against the admin plane, so its env file needs the token:

sealed setting: RELAY_SECRET13=bca49b02a6971